Leila Nazarian is an alumna of the Master of Public Diplomacy program at USC. She also holds a Bachelor’s in International and Comparative Politics, as well as a Master’s in Middle Eastern Studies from the American University of Paris. She has previously assisted with fundraising activities for the Center for Global Engagement and Farhang Foundation.
